The PDC  stars head to Copenhagen this weekend for the 2021 Nordic Darts Masters and we will have everything covered in one place at Online Darts.

From September 17 to 18, 16 players will compete in the inaugural PDC World Series event in Denmark.

The Nordic Darts Masters will pit eight of the region’s best players against eight of the sport’s best players.

Gerwyn Price, the defending World Champion, and Michael van Gerwen, the three-time World Champion, lead the field of PDC stars.

Peter Wright, the current World Matchplay champion, and Jonny Clayton, the current Masters and Premier League champion, will also compete.

Gary Anderson, Dimitri Van den Bergh and Nathan Aspinall will compete, as will Fallon Sherrock, the first female player to win a match in the PDC World Championship two years ago.

PDC Tour Card Holders Darius Labanauskas, Madars Razma, Daniel Larsson, and Marko Kantele will lead the Nordic & Baltic competitors, representing Lithuania, Latvia, Sweden, and Finland, respectively.

Andreas Toft Jrgensen, Niels Heinse, and Ivan Springborg of Denmark will represent their country, while Johan Engström of Sweden completes the field after winning the PDC Nordic & Baltic qualifying.

The first round will be played over the best of 11 legs, while the quarter-finals, semi-finals, and final will be played over the best of 15.

Schedule for 2021 Nordic Darts Masters (PDC)

2021 Nordic Darts Masters

 

Friday September 17 (1900 local time, 1800 BST)

First Round

 

Dimitri Van den Bergh v Johan Engström

Jonny Clayton v Ivan Springborg Poulsen

Nathan Aspinall v Madars Razma

Gerwyn Price v Daniel Larsson

Gary Anderson v Andreas Toft Jørgensen

Fallon Sherrock v Niels Heinsøe

Peter Wright v Marko Kantele

Michael van Gerwen v Darius Labanauskas

 

Saturday September 18

Afternoon Session (1300 local time, 1200 BST)

Quarter-Finals

 

Price/Larsson v Sherrock/Heinsøe

Van den Bergh/Engström v Anderson/Toft Jørgensen

Wright/Kantele v Clayton/Springborg Poulsen

Van Gerwen/Labanauskas v Aspinall/Razma

 

Evening Session (2000 local time, 1900 BST)

 

Semi-Finals

 

Final

 

Prize Fund

Winner: £20,000

Runner-up: £10,000

Semi-Final losers: £5,000

Quarter-Final losers: £2,500

First Round losers: £1,250
